1. The Ancient Metropolis: Where History Meets Modernity 🏺

Welcome to Varanasi, a city that has been around since 1200 BCE and is often called the spiritual capital of India. With a population of about 1.5 million, it ranks as the 20th largest city in India. But size isn’t everything here. 🏙️
Fun fact: Varanasi is one of the world’s oldest continuously inhabited cities. It’s where the Ganges River meets the spiritual aspirations of millions. 🌊🙏

2. Environmental Challenges: The Ganges and Beyond 🌍

The Ganges River, the lifeblood of Varanasi, faces significant environmental issues. Pollution from industrial waste, untreated sewage, and religious rituals has turned parts of the river into a toxic soup. 🚧🌊
But there’s hope! The Indian government’s Namami Gange project aims to clean and conserve the river. Local communities and NGOs are also stepping up to protect this sacred waterway. 🌱💪

3. Cultural Significance: More Than Just a City 🕉️

Varanasi is not just a place; it’s a pilgrimage. Hindus believe that dying in Varanasi and being cremated along the banks of the Ganges can break the cycle of rebirth and lead to salvation. 🕯️🌟
Beyond religion, Varanasi is a hub for art, music, and literature. The city has inspired countless poets, philosophers, and artists over the centuries. It’s a living museum of Indian culture. 🎶📚
